Oil Furnace Replacement in Monmouth County, NJ
Oil furnace replacement services involve removing an existing oil-powered heating system and installing a new, more efficient model. These projects typically address situations where an old furnace is no longer functioning properly, has become inefficient, or is nearing the end of its lifespan. Property owners often seek this service to ensure consistent, reliable heating during colder months, improve energy savings, or upgrade to newer technology that offers better performance and safety features.
Before requesting an oil furnace replacement, homeowners should understand the size and heating requirements of their property, as well as the compatibility of the new system with existing ductwork and infrastructure. It’s also helpful to consider the potential impact on energy costs and the overall efficiency of the new furnace. Property owners may want to inquire about the installation process, any necessary modifications to their current setup, and options for upgrading to more advanced models to meet their heating needs effectively.

Oil Furnace Replacement Questions
When should a homeowner consider replacing an oil furnace? Replacement is recommended when the furnace frequently requires repairs, shows signs of inefficiency, or is nearing the end of its typical lifespan.
What are common signs indicating an oil furnace needs replacement? Signs include inconsistent heating, unusual noises, increased energy bills, or the presence of rust and corrosion.
What types of oil furnaces are available for replacement? Options include standard, high-efficiency, and modulating models, each suited to different heating needs and property sizes.
How can property owners prepare for an oil furnace replacement? Clearing access to the furnace area and providing detailed information about current heating systems can help facilitate the replacement process.
